Learning and unlearning are both critical parts of growth – can you share a story of a time when you had to unlearn a lesson?
A lesson that I am still continuing to unlearn is the fear of being perceived.
An unfortunate reality that I’ve had to face is that I really have a hard time being the center of attention. I usually prefer to sit in the corner and avoid bothering anyone. For a while this was great, I could do my own thing and be confident that no one had a problem with me. But after a while I realized that in order to tell the stories that I want to tell, I would have to get my hands dirty and raise my voice a bit.
Telling stories that the world needs to hear is not a passive activity. And for some reason I had to wrestle with this – I enjoyed doing my own thing and avoiding confrontation. However, the stark reality was that I would never accomplish what I was trying to do with this approach. So, each day I push myself more and more to be an active participant in my industry. To call myself a director or editor or whatever term I can think of would be a lie if I sit in my corner and play it safe.
